    Class performance proplem.

    Hi i got all the exp packs to open for business, and im haveing some proplems with my player in college(all my players).

    Look, when he was teen i trained hes skills a lot. Then i went to college and i looked at my class performance and looked at the skills to raise the performance meter. There were few skills highlighted (but only the 1st points) and when i train them the meter doesnt raise... im stuck at c+ or somthing. plz help me.

    You gotta make them do their class assignments but your skill points will help your sim during lessons. :)

    To do the assignment, click on your sim and then choose 'Do Assignment' and it will get a note pad out and start working. It's pretty easy. The next time your sim comes home from a long day in class, their meter will have gone up. Your sim can also write the term paper on the computer and their meter will go up really high! (After your sim has gone to class, of course :rolleyes:.)

    The term paper takes longer time for your sims to do than the assignments. So make sure his/her needs are all in the green if you don't want them storming off in a huff in the middle of everything! :winks:

    I dont think thats quite what he meant - but I understand why you misunderstood him, I most likely wouldve too if I werent on my search for a solution for this specific bug. ;)

    The thing is that the meter you want to fill by going to classes, writing term paper and such stuff never expands when you learn the skills that should make them expand - hope I explained it a bit better, Im pretty sure thats what the thread starter is talking about at least. :)

    Im looking for a solution as Im posting this - Ill update my post when I find one.

    Update 1: I just uninstalled Open for Business and that solved the problem. After installing it agian the problem was back. Gonna try reinstalling from the scratch - doubt it will be any difference though.

    Update 2: Ok, so I reinstalled everything - when I was done installing University and Business I loaded up one of the premade students and moved in and I saw his performance bar was actually the size it should be. However, when I changed major (and tried with multiple sims after - both premade and selfmade) it went back to being stuck at lowest level. So guess Im gonna remove Business agian and install it when Im done on Uni - seems like the solution for me. :\
